Undergraduate programs
Programs

Imagine designing a building that can supply its own energy. That’s one of the key challenges that building engineers tackle every day. As a building engineer, you will find creative solutions to reduce energy consumption, help combat global warming and improve quality of life. You’ll create a synergy between the thermal, structural, acoustic and energy systems of a building by applying the principles civil, mechanical and electrical engineering.
Department
Department of Building, Civil and Environmental Engineering
Faculty

Protect water resources. Design buildings, bridges and tunnels. Improve transportation and traffic flow. As a civil engineer, your expertise in urban and environmental planning lets you guide municipalities to create the structures and systems that have a positive impact on everyday community life.
Department
Department of Building, Civil and Environmental Engineering
Faculty

Without computer hardware there would be no smart phones, DVD players and digital recorders or computerized medical devices. As a computer engineer, your knowledge of computer architecture, digital electronics, circuits and digital communication will lead to new innovations or bring about another information revolution.
Department
Department of Electrical and Computer Engineering
Faculty

The Computer Applications option gives doubly passionate students the flexibility to combine a traditional computer science degree and with a non-traditional field. Though many students complete a Major in Computation Arts or a Major in Mathematics and Statistics, students may declare a major or minor in any area outside the Faculty of Engineering and Computer Science.
Department
Department of Computer Science and Software Engineering
Faculty

Basic computer science skills are the perfect complement to any degree program at Concordia. The minor in Computer Science is designed to meet the growing demand of computer-literate professionals, and may offer students more career opportunities after graduation.
Department
Department of Computer Science and Software Engineering
Faculty

Stimulate the senses. Engage the mind. When you study computation arts, you become a digital artist, using algorithms and computational theory to create interactive multimedia that breaks new audio-visual ground. Computation Arts is Creative Computing – with a capital C.
Department
Department of Computer Science and Software Engineering
Faculty

Crunch numbers to the nth degree — and see what happens. When you study computer science and mathematics, you’ll use algorithms and computational theory to create mathematical models or define formulas that solve mathematical problems. In other words, you design new tools that can predict the future.
Department
Department of Computer Science and Software Engineering
Faculty

Control energy with a flip of a switch. Design next-generation microchips or flight control systems. As electrical engineers you rein in electrons, guide them through the devices we depend on every day — whether they are very small (like the microchips in our cell phones) or very large (like the power grids or charging stations for electric cars).
Department
Department of Electrical and Computer Engineering
Faculty

The BCompSc in Health and Life Sciences will place you at the rich intersection of computer science and biology, providing a solid foundation in computer science while giving you the additional knowledge and skills to pursue a career or further studies in the health and life sciences.
Department
Department of Computer Science and Software Engineering
Faculty

The Kaié:ri Nikawerà:ke Indigenous Bridging Program is a path to university education for First Nations, Inuit and Métis students who do not meet Concordia’s conventional admission requirements. The program will be offered for students interested in bridging into the Bachelor of Engineering (BEng) degree.
Faculty

Use your knowledge of human behaviour, equipment, information and modes of communication to develop processes that work. Industrial engineers are experts in optimization who apply mathematics, engineering and psychological principles to improve productivity, safety and quality. A knack for project management can lead to a career in many different economic sectors.
Department
Department of Mechanical, Industrial and Aerospace Engineering
Faculty

Build engines. Design robots. Control explosions. As a mechanical engineer, you will create, construct and control machines. Whether it’s a vehicle, an aircraft engine or an assembly line, mechanical engineers know how to fit that square peg into a round hole, and do it with a little finesse.
Department
Department of Mechanical, Industrial and Aerospace Engineering
Faculty

This is a non-degree program that caters to students who wish to prepare for admission to a degree program in engineering or computer science. It is not intended for students who wish to prepare for admission towards a science program.
Department
Faculty

Design, code, and test software products – with the big picture in mind. Think financial software, airline ticketing systems or information databases. As a software engineer, your expertise in analog/digital signal processing, microprocessors, microwaves and fibre optics will give you the tools to tackle these challenges everyday.
Department
Department of Computer Science and Software Engineering
Faculty
See how you would fit in
Find out more about the university life, campus tours, financial aid, and how to apply.